Who was Henry Normand MacLaurin?

Brigadier General Henry Normand MacLaurin was a barrister and Australian Army Colonel who served in World War I. He was shot dead by a Turkish sniper at Gallipoli on 27 April 1915.

He was subsequently promoted to Brigadier General when all AIF brigade commanders were thus promoted.
